Who Are Arch Manning's Parents?
Arch Manning's parents are Cooper Manning and Danyelle Willé Manning.
Cooper Manning is a former American football player who played college football at the University of Mississippi. He was a highly touted prospect, but a spinal condition forced him to retire from football before his senior season.
Danyelle Willé Manning is a former Ole Miss cheerleader and a devoted mother to Arch and his two siblings, May and Red.
